Hello everyone!

We are currently deploying a 3cx system. The virtual machine was installed using the official 3cx iso. Now, we run PROXMOX and I need my guest-tools and I need them updated without manual intervention. I can go into the apt sources, add the Debian Main Buster source and can then install the software. Seems to work, but it turns out, 3cx wipes these settings when updated, which is probably expected behavior as I have also read before to avoid modifying the 3cx sources.

How do I install the package qemu-guest-agent AND keep it updated automatically without circumventing the 3cx repositories?
